In 2023, Whiteville, TN had a population of 4.69k people with a median age of 38.7 and a median household income of $43,438. Between 2022 and 2023 the population of Whiteville, TN declined from 4,734 to 4,689, a −0.951% decrease and its median household income declined from $46,138 to $43,438, a −5.85% decrease.
The 5 largest ethnic groups in Whiteville, TN are White (Non-Hispanic) (45.9%), Black or African American (Non-Hispanic) (44.6%), Two+ (Non-Hispanic) (3.97%), White (Hispanic) (1.94%), and Two+ (Hispanic) (1.34%).
None of the households in Whiteville, TN reported speaking a non-English language at home as their primary shared language. This does not consider the potential multi-lingual nature of households, but only the primary self-reported language spoken by all members of the household.
97.2% of the residents in Whiteville, TN are U.S. citizens.

In 2023, the median property value in Whiteville, TN was $87,000, and the homeownership rate was 40.7%.
Most people in Whiteville, TN drove alone to work, and the average commute time was 27.7 minutes. The average car ownership in Whiteville, TN was 2 cars per household.
